|
Commitments and Contingencies (Details)
$ in Thousands
|
Oct. 31, 2019
USD ($)
|Operating Leases
|2020 (remainder of fiscal year)
|$ 3,027
|2021
|14,174
|2022
|19,070
|2023
|18,444
|2024 and thereafter
|141,281
|Total payments
|195,996
|Other
|2020 (remainder of fiscal year)
|11,515
|2021
|10,883
|2022
|3,716
|2023
|601
|2024 and thereafter
|428
|Total payments
|$ 27,143
|X
- Definition
+ References
Amount of contractual obligation, including but not limited to, long-term debt, capital lease obligations, operating lease obligations, purchase obligations, and other commitments.
+ Details
No definition available.
|X
- Definition
+ References
Amount of contractual obligation due in the fourth fiscal year following the latest fiscal year. Excludes interim and annual periods when interim periods are reported on a rolling approach, from latest balance sheet date.
+ Details
No definition available.
|X
- Definition
+ References
Amount of contractual obligation due in the second fiscal year following the latest fiscal year. Excludes interim and annual periods when interim periods are reported on a rolling approach, from latest balance sheet date.
+ Details
No definition available.
|X
- Definition
+ References
Amount of contractual obligation due in the third fiscal year following the latest fiscal year. Excludes interim and annual periods when interim periods are reported on a rolling approach, from latest balance sheet date.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of contractual obligation maturing in the remainder of the fiscal year following the latest fiscal year ended.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Contractual Obligation, Due In Fifth Year And Thereafter
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Due
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Due Year Five And Thereafter
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Due Year Four
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Due Year Three
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Due Year Two
+ Details
No definition available.
|X
- Definition
+ References
Lessee, Operating Lease Including Lease Not Yet Commenced, Payments, Remainder Of Fiscal Year
+ Details
No definition available.